Merge branch 'sctp-gso'
Marcelo Ricardo Leitner says: ==================== sctp: Add GSO support This patchset adds sctp GSO support. Performance tests indicates that increases throughput by 10% if using bigger chunk sizes, specially if bigger than MTU. For small chunks, it doesn't help much if not using heavy firewall rules. For small chunks it will probably be of more use once we get something like MSG_MORE as David Laight had suggested. overall changes: v1->v2: Added support for receiving GSO frames on SCTP stack, as requested by Dave Miller. v2->v3: Consider sctphdr size in skb_gso_transport_seglen() rebased due to 5c7cdf339af5 ("gso: Remove arbitrary checks for unsupported GSO") ==================== Signed-off-by: David S.
